Maximizing Your DB2 Database Efficiency

Maximizing Your DB2 Database Efficiency: Expert Consultation

In the digital era, data is one of the most vital assets for any organization. Efficient management and seamless processing of data are key in ensuring an organization operates optimally, decisions are made promptly and accurately, and customer needs are handled with precision. Among the various databases that large enterprises utilize, the DB2 database stands out due to its high performance, reliability, and scalability features.

However, achieving and maintaining peak DB2 database efficiency requires constant attention and fine-tuning. This is where DB2 optimization techniques come into play, guided by expert consultation to ensure your systems are running at their full potential.

Understanding DB2 Database Efficiency

DB2 database efficiency encompasses the speed, reliability, and effectiveness with which your database processes requests and manages data. It involves minimizing resource usage, whether concerning time, CPU power, or memory, and maximizing output quality and speed. Efficient databases contribute significantly to reduced operational costs, improved performance, and, ultimately, increased business success.

DB2 optimization revolves around fine-tuning various aspects of the database — from the underlying hardware and SQL queries to database design and configurations. Employing the right db2 optimization techniques is paramount, as these determine how well your DB2 system adapts to the growing demands and complexities of big data in contemporary business environments.

Why Efficiency Matters?

In the competitive business landscape, efficiency is not a luxury; it’s a necessity. Enhanced DB2 database efficiency results in

  1. Faster Transactions: This equates to quicker query responses, allowing for real-time data analysis and reporting, which is crucial for making informed business decisions.
  2. Reduced Costs: Efficient systems use fewer resources. When you save on resources like memory, CPU cycles, and storage, you reduce overall operational costs.
  3. Improved Scalability: An optimized DB2 system handles increased workload smoothly, without the need for significant additional resources.
  4. Customer Satisfaction: Efficiency means faster, uninterrupted access to data, leading to better user experiences and, consequently, higher customer satisfaction rates.

Common Challenges in DB2 Database Efficiency

Several obstacles could prevent you from achieving maximum DB2 database efficiency, including

  • Inefficient Data Models: Without the proper structure, data retrieval and writing become resource-intensive, slowing down processes.
  • Poorly Designed Indexes: Inappropriate or excessive indexes can lead to increased processing time.
  • Suboptimal SQL Queries: Poorly written SQL queries are a significant contributor to performance degradation.
  • Resource Contention: Unmanaged competition for resources can lead to bottlenecks, significantly affecting performance.
  • Inadequate Maintenance: Regular maintenance tasks like reorganization, backups, and stats updates are vital for sustained performance.

Addressing these challenges requires a comprehensive understanding of DB2 databases and a mastery of DB2 optimization techniques, which are best guided by professional DB2 consulting services.

The Role of DB2 Consulting Services

DB2 consulting services offer a reservoir of experience and expertise, assisting in various dimensions such as auditing the current system, understanding bespoke organizational needs, and implementing tailored optimization strategies. Consultants bring fresh insights into your DB2 system, identifying inefficiencies that internal IT teams might overlook due to familiarity or resource constraints.

These experts not only apply proven db2 optimization techniques but also train your in-house team to incorporate best practices in their daily operations, ensuring long-term sustainability of your DB2 database efficiency.

Choosing the Right DB2 Consulting Partner

Selecting a DB2 consultant is a decision that can make or break your database’s efficiency. Consider the following before making your choice

  1. Experience and Expertise: Look for professionals who have a substantial track record in handling DB2 databases similar to your scale or industry.
  2. Customized Approach: Each business is unique. The right consultant understands this and offers solutions tailored to your specific needs rather than generic fixes.
  3. Comprehensive Service: From diagnosing issues to implementing changes, and providing post-optimization support, a good partner handles the process from start to finish.
  4. Client Feedback: Positive testimonials and case studies from previous clients can be a reliable gauge of the quality you can expect.

Consultation Process

The typical consultation process involves several phases:

  • Assessment: The consultant examines your current DB2 setup, including configurations, queries, usage patterns, and more.
  • Identification: Post-assessment, they identify the bottlenecks, and potential areas of improvement, and devise a roadmap for optimization.
  • Optimization Implementation: Using advanced db2 optimization techniques, the consultant will restructure data models, rewrite or fine-tune queries, redesign indexes, and more.
  • Review and Guidance: After implementing the changes, they review the system’s performance. They also provide guidance for maintaining this optimized state.

Consultants bring invaluable insights and advanced db2 optimization techniques to the table, addressing not just current performance issues but also equipping your teams with the knowledge to maintain optimal efficiency. As technology evolves, the strategies for DB2 optimization will also advance. Staying ahead of these trends through expert partnerships will be a cornerstone for any data-driven organization’s success.

In a world where data is king, ensuring your DB2 databases are operating at peak efficiency is not just an operational concern—it’s a strategic imperative.

Leave a Comment